React.js Development Trends in 2025: Top Agencies' Secrets Revealed
Programming Insider4 days ago
890

React.js Development Trends in 2025: Top Agencies' Secrets Revealed

Best Practices
reactjs
servercomponents
typescript
hybridrendering
performance
Share this content:

Summary:

  • React Server Components (RSC) and streaming interfaces boost performance and reduce bundle size.

  • Hybrid rendering (Next.js, Remix, Astro) optimizes loading speed and SEO.

  • TypeScript is becoming the default for improved code quality and maintainability.

  • Modern state management tools (Zustand, Recoil, React Query) offer flexible solutions for various project scales.

  • Prioritizing Core Web Vitals and accessibility (WCAG) is crucial for SEO and user experience.

  • Component-driven development and design systems improve efficiency and brand consistency.

  • Micro-frontends enhance scalability for large-scale applications.

  • Integrating AI/ML and WebAssembly further extends React's capabilities.

  • React Native remains a strong choice for cross-platform mobile development.

React.js Development Trends Shaping 2025

React Logo

React.js remains a dominant force in web and mobile development. Leading agencies are leveraging cutting-edge methodologies to meet the growing demands for performance, scalability, and adaptability. Let's explore the key trends:

Server Components and Streaming:

React Server Components (RSC) significantly reduce client-side JavaScript, improving speed and reducing bundle size. Streaming interfaces deliver essential content instantly, enhancing user experience, especially beneficial for SaaS and enterprise dashboards.

Hybrid Rendering:

Frameworks like Next.js, Remix, and Astro combine Static Site Generation (SSG) and Server-Side Rendering (SSR). This approach prioritizes fast loading for frequently accessed content while dynamically updating user-specific information. This is ideal for news sites, e-commerce platforms, and content-heavy websites.

Concurrent Rendering and Suspense:

Concurrent rendering prioritizes urgent tasks, ensuring smooth user experience even with complex operations. Suspense simplifies asynchronous operations, making loading states easier to manage. These features are particularly valuable for real-time applications.

TypeScript Dominance:

TypeScript is becoming the standard for React projects due to its static type checking, preventing bugs and improving team collaboration. Its use minimizes long-term maintenance costs, especially in large-scale projects.

Evolving State Management:

While Redux remains relevant, alternatives like Zustand, Recoil, and React Query offer various advantages depending on project size and complexity. The choice depends on factors like application scale and complexity, ensuring optimized performance and workflows.

Performance Optimization and Core Web Vitals:

Optimizing Core Web Vitals (FID, LCP, CLS) is crucial for SEO. Techniques like image optimization, lazy loading, and code chunking are essential to improve these metrics and boost conversion rates.

Accessibility, SEO, and PWAs:

Accessibility is a top priority. Agencies integrate WCAG standards for inclusive design. Progressive Web Apps (PWAs) provide offline functionality and push notifications, enhancing user experience and retention, especially valuable in retail and travel apps.

Component-Driven Development:

Component-driven development (CDD) and design systems using tools like Storybook streamline development, improve brand consistency, and minimize bugs. This is particularly beneficial for large organizations with multiple digital products.

Micro-Frontends:

Micro-frontends enable independent development of application parts, accelerating deployment and improving scalability for complex, large-scale projects in industries like fintech and healthcare.

AI and Machine Learning Integration:

Integrating AI features like chatbots and personalized recommendations enhances user engagement and improves application functionality.

WebAssembly for Enhanced Performance:

WebAssembly (Wasm) enables high-performance tasks directly in the browser, reducing the need for heavy software installations.

React Native for Cross-Platform Development:

React Native simplifies cross-platform mobile development, sharing code between web and mobile, while maintaining near-native performance.

FAQs:

  • What makes a React.js agency stand out? Integration of AI, TypeScript adoption, use of modern frameworks (Next.js, Astro), and sustainable solutions are key differentiators.
  • Which industries benefit most from React.js? Healthcare, finance, SaaS, e-commerce, media & entertainment, and banking sectors are heavily adopting React for its scalability and performance.
  • Is React Native still relevant for mobile development? Yes, it offers cost-effective development and near-native performance.

Comments

0

Join Our Community

Sign up to share your thoughts, engage with others, and become part of our growing community.

No comments yet

Be the first to share your thoughts and start the conversation!

Newsletter

Subscribe our newsletter to receive our daily digested news

Join our newsletter and get the latest updates delivered straight to your inbox.

ReactRemoteJobs.com logo

ReactRemoteJobs.com

Get ReactRemoteJobs.com on your phone!